Création de rapports personnalisés à l’aide de vues SQL Server dans Configuration Manager

Configuration Manager requêtes SQL Server vues dans la base de données du site Configuration Manager pour récupérer les informations affichées dans les rapports. La base de données du site Configuration Manager contient une grande collection d’informations sur le réseau, les ordinateurs, les utilisateurs, les groupes d’utilisateurs et de nombreux autres composants de l’environnement informatique. La base de données contient également des objets qui représentent Configuration Manager opérations, telles que les déploiements, les mises à jour logicielles, les bases de référence de configuration, les rapports et les messages d’état. Configuration Manager administrateurs doivent comprendre les différentes catégories des vues SQL, les informations stockées dans chaque vue et la façon dont les vues SQL peuvent être jointes les unes aux autres pour créer des rapports qui retournent les informations requises. Étant donné que Configuration Manager requêtes et collections récupèrent des informations à partir de WMI (Windows Management Instrumentation) au lieu d’Configuration Manager vues SQL, il est également utile de savoir comment le schéma de vue SQL est lié au schéma WMI.

Cette documentation part du principe que vous avez une compréhension de base des instructions Configuration Manager et SQL, que vous disposez d’une infrastructure Configuration Manager opérationnelle et que vous avez une compréhension de base des rapports Configuration Manager. Pour plus d’informations sur la création de rapports dans Configuration Manager, consultez Présentation des rapports. Pour plus d’informations sur l’écriture d’instructions SQL de base, consultez votre documentation SQL Server.

Cette documentation inclut une vue d’ensemble du schéma de vue SQL Configuration Manager et des vues SQL, une vue d’ensemble des rapports existants et des procédures de création de rapports associées, des exemples d’instructions SQL pour chaque catégorie de vue SQL Configuration Manager, des exercices de création de rapports personnalisés, une vue d’ensemble de l’écriture d’instructions SQL de rapport et une vue d’ensemble de la vue d’ensemble de la vue d’ensemble schéma WMI du fournisseur Configuration Manager.

Versions de produit utilisées dans ce document

Ce document a été créé à l’aide de Microsoft SQL Server 2012, Report Builder 3.0 et Configuration Manager. Les vues, options et commandes SQL disponibles peuvent varier en fonction de la version de chaque produit que vous utilisez. Pour plus d’informations, consultez la documentation relative aux produits que vous utilisez.

Nouveautés de la création de rapports dans Configuration Manager

Cette section répertorie les modifications apportées depuis Configuration Manager 2007 pour les rapports Configuration Manager.

  • Configuration Manager n’utilise plus le point de création de rapports ; le point reporting services est le seul rôle de système de site que Configuration Manager utilise désormais pour la création de rapports.

  • Intégration complète de la solution SQL Server Reporting Services Configuration Manager 2007 R2 : en plus de la gestion de rapports standard, Configuration Manager 2007 R2 a introduit la prise en charge de SQL Server Reporting Services la création de rapports. Configuration Manager intègre la solution Reporting Services, ajoute de nouvelles fonctionnalités et supprime la gestion de rapports standard en tant que solution de création de rapports.

  • Intégration de Report Builder 2.0 : Configuration Manager utilise Microsoft SQL Server 2008 Reporting Services Report Builder 2.0 comme outil de création et d’édition exclusif pour les modèles et Rapports basés sur SQL. Report Builder 2.0 est automatiquement installé lorsque vous créez ou modifiez un rapport pour la première fois.

  • Les abonnements aux rapports dans SQL Server Reporting Services vous permettent de configurer la remise automatique des rapports spécifiés par e-mail ou à un partage de fichiers à intervalles planifiés.

  • Vous pouvez exécuter des rapports Configuration Manager dans la console Configuration Manager à l’aide de la Visionneuse de rapports, ou vous pouvez exécuter des rapports à partir d’un navigateur à l’aide du Gestionnaire de rapports. Les deux méthodes d’exécution de rapports offrent une expérience similaire.

  • Les rapports dans Configuration Manager sont rendus dans les paramètres régionaux de la console Configuration Manager installée. Les abonnements sont rendus dans les paramètres régionaux que SQL Server Reporting Services est installé. Lorsque vous créez un rapport, vous pouvez spécifier l’assembly et l’expression.

  • Lorsque Microsoft SQL Server 2012 ou SQL Server 2008 R2 s’exécute sur le point de Reporting Services, Configuration Manager s’ouvre Reporting Services Report Builder 3.0 lorsque vous créez ou modifiez des rapports. Lorsque Microsoft SQL Server 2008 s’exécute sur le point de Reporting Services, Configuration Manager s’ouvre Reporting Services Report Builder 2.0 lorsque vous créez ou modifiez des rapports.

  • L’espace de travail Surveillance dans la console Configuration Manager affiche désormais des liens vers SQL Server Reporting Services Gestionnaire de rapports à partir du nœud Création de rapports.

  • Configuration Manager rapports sont désormais entièrement activés pour l’administration basée sur les rôles. Les données de tous les rapports inclus dans Configuration Manager sont filtrées en fonction des autorisations de l’utilisateur administratif qui exécute le rapport. Les utilisateurs administratifs disposant de rôles spécifiques peuvent uniquement afficher les informations définies pour leurs rôles. Pour plus d’informations, consultez la section Planning for Role-Based Administration for Reports dans l’article Planning for Reporting in Configuration Manager de la bibliothèque de documentation Configuration Manager.

Dans cette section

  • SQL Server vues dans Configuration Manager
    Fournit une vue d’ensemble des vues que vous pouvez utiliser pour créer des rapports dans Configuration Manager.

  • Utilisation des rapports dans Configuration Manager
    Fournit une vue d’ensemble des rapports Configuration Manager, des éléments d’un rapport et des procédures que vous pouvez utiliser pour créer et gérer des rapports.

  • Référence technique pour les vues SQL Server dans Configuration Manager
    Fournit des exemples d’instructions SQL pour chaque catégorie de vue SQL Configuration Manager, des exercices pour modifier des rapports Configuration Manager existants et créer de nouveaux rapports, des informations sur l’écriture d’instructions SQL et les outils de conception de requête disponibles dans SQL Server qui peuvent être utilisés lors de l’écriture d’instructions SQL de rapport, et une vue d’ensemble de l’instruction Configuration Manager schéma du fournisseur WMI.

Voir aussi